Municipal Planning Commission

The Planning Commission plays a crucial role in shaping the city’s future by overseeing land use, development, and community growth. As an advisory body to the Mayor and Board of Aldermen, the Commission ensures that development projects align with the city’s comprehensive plan, zoning ordinances, and community vision.

Who We Are

The Planning Commission consists of five members. Two of these are the mayor and an alderman, while the other three are community members appointed by the mayor. The mayor and alderman’s term run concurrently with their terms of office. The remaining members have a five year appointment.

Meeting Information

The Planning Commission meets on an as-needed basis before the Board of Mayor and Aldermen meetings.
